Actionable Steps to Build Momentum

Reaching 1000 isn’t a sprint; it’s a marathon with strategic pit stops. Start by auditing your content—does it resonate like a well-tuned guitar or fall flat? Here’s where the real work begins, with steps that vary in intensity to keep things dynamic.

  • Step 1: Optimize Your Online Presence – Begin with your platform’s basics. For instance, if you’re on YouTube, craft thumbnails that pop like unexpected fireworks in a night sky, using tools like Canva to test colors and fonts. Aim for SEO-friendly titles; a video titled “Quick Hacks for Daily Productivity” might outperform a vague one, drawing in search traffic and boosting early views.
  • Step 2: Create a Content Calendar – Consistency is your ally, like a steady drumbeat in a symphony. Map out weekly posts using free tools like Trello, focusing on themes that align with your audience’s interests. If you’re a fitness influencer, alternate between high-energy workout videos and introspective recovery tips to build emotional layers, turning viewers into subscribers over time.
  • Step 3: Engage Actively with Your Community – Don’t just broadcast; converse. Reply to comments as if you’re chatting with old friends, and host live sessions where subscribers feel like insiders at an exclusive gathering. One creator I followed turned Q&A livestreams into gold, gaining 200 subscribers in a month by addressing niche questions, like “How do I adapt workouts for small apartments?”
  • Step 4: Leverage Collaborations – Partnering can multiply your reach faster than ripples in a pond. Reach out to peers in your niche for guest appearances or cross-promotions. Imagine teaming up with a fellow podcaster for a joint episode; it could expose your content to their 500 subscribers, creating a mutual surge that edges you closer to 1000.
  • Step 5: Track and Adapt Your Progress – Use metrics as your compass. If email open rates hover below 20%, tweak your subject lines to intrigue rather than inform—think “Unlock the Secret to Effortless Mornings” instead of “Morning Routine Tips.” I’ve witnessed campaigns where mid-adjustments, like A/B testing calls-to-action, flipped stagnant growth into a steady climb.

Practical Tips for Sustaining Growth

Once you’re nearing 1000, the challenge shifts to maintaining that energy, like keeping a fire alive in a brisk wind. Here’s where practical wisdom shines through, with tips that draw from real-world observations and a touch of subjective insight.

  • Experiment with timing; posting when your audience is most active can feel like hitting a sweet spot in baseball, yielding higher interaction. I once advised a client to shift uploads to evenings, resulting in a 15% uptick in subscriptions overnight.
  • Invest in evergreen content that ages like fine wine—tutorials or guides that keep drawing traffic long after publication, providing a steady subscriber trickle.
  • Monetize thoughtfully; offering exclusive perks, such as bonus episodes for subscribers, can create loyalty without seeming pushy. In my view, it’s the emotional pull that turns a subscriber into a advocate, sharing your content like a trusted recommendation.
  • Guard against burnout by scheduling breaks; think of it as recharging your own engine, ensuring your passion doesn’t fizzle when you’re just steps from the goal.
  • Finally, blend analytics with intuition—data might suggest one path, but your gut could reveal untapped angles, like exploring a new social platform that aligns with emerging trends.
